The Cats finished the Ark City tournament with a win over Ark City, fall to Augusta and Coffeyville.

MHS - Men's Soccer / September 14, 2020 By Kasey McDowell


The Mulvane Men's Soccer team traveled to Ark City last week three times for the Ark City tournament and the Cats finished their tournament play with a win over the host Bulldogs and losses against Augusta and Coffeyville.

The Cats faced the Bulldogs on Saturday, September 12th in their last game of the tournament. Senior Caleb Perkins, junior Kelton Boster, and junior Chase Nash all kicked one into the net and sophomore Ben Thorson grabbed an assist in the game. Senior Jesse Velota stat'd 12 saves with 13 shots on goal as the Wildcats won 3-1.

The Cats were not able to get any into the net against Augusta or Coffeyville as they fell 0-10 and 0-2 respectively. Jesse had 20 saves with 26 shots on goal and sophomore Alex Dial had 4 saves with 8 shots on goal against Augusta. Jesse Velota had 15 saves with17 shots on goal against Coffeyville.

The Cats will travel to Augusta on Tuesday, September 15th, with the JV game starting at 5:00 PM and varsity around 6:30 PM.
